fre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

08單片機(jī)串行數(shù)據(jù)通信技術(shù)-預(yù)覽頁

2025-02-08 17:31 上一頁面

下一頁面
 

【正文】 ]奇偶位 停止位 起始位位時(shí)間 串行通信基礎(chǔ)知識(shí) 由于字符編碼方式的不同,數(shù)據(jù)位可以是 7或 8位。停止位在一幀的最后,它可能是 2位,在實(shí)際中根據(jù)需要確定。 串行通信基礎(chǔ)知識(shí)同步通信下圖 同步通信的數(shù)據(jù)格式 同步通信中,在數(shù)據(jù)開始傳送前用同步字符來指示(常約定 1~ 2個(gè)),并由時(shí)鐘來實(shí)現(xiàn)發(fā)送端和接收端同步,即檢測(cè)到規(guī)定的同步字符后,下面就連續(xù)按順序傳送數(shù)據(jù),直到通信告一段落。按同步方式通信時(shí),先發(fā)送同步字符,接收方檢測(cè)到同步字符后,即準(zhǔn)備接收數(shù)據(jù)。 串行通信基礎(chǔ)知識(shí)三、串行通信的數(shù)據(jù)通路形式 因此半雙工形式既可以使用一條數(shù)據(jù)線,也可以使用兩條數(shù)據(jù)線,如上圖所示。 這種數(shù)據(jù)傳送方式稱之為 基帶傳送方式 。近程串行通信只需用傳輸線 把兩端的接口電路直接連起來 即可實(shí)現(xiàn),既方便又經(jīng)濟(jì)。 這種數(shù)據(jù)傳送方式就稱為 頻帶傳送 方式。假設(shè)數(shù)據(jù)傳送速率是 120bps,而每個(gè)字符格式包含 10個(gè)代碼位( 1個(gè)起始位、 1個(gè)終止位、 8個(gè)數(shù)據(jù)位),這時(shí)傳送的波特率為: l0l20bps=1 200bps 每一位代碼的傳送時(shí)間 td為波特率的倒數(shù)。接收 /發(fā)送時(shí)鐘就是用來控制通信設(shè)備接收 /發(fā)送字符數(shù)據(jù)速度的,該時(shí)鐘信號(hào)通常由微機(jī)內(nèi)部時(shí)鐘電路產(chǎn)生。 對(duì)于同步傳送方式,必須取 n=l,即接收 /發(fā)送時(shí)鐘的頻率等于收/發(fā)波特率。當(dāng)發(fā)送設(shè)備要發(fā)送一個(gè)字符數(shù)據(jù)時(shí),首先發(fā)出一個(gè)邏輯 “0”信號(hào),這個(gè)邏輯低電平就是起始位。數(shù)據(jù)位的個(gè)數(shù)可以是 7或 8, PC機(jī)中經(jīng)常采用 7位或 8位數(shù)據(jù)傳送, 8051串行口采用 8位或 9位數(shù)據(jù)傳送。奇偶校驗(yàn)用于有限差錯(cuò)檢測(cè),通信雙方應(yīng)約定一致的奇偶校驗(yàn)方式。接收設(shè)備收到停止位之后,通信線路上便又恢復(fù)邏輯 “1”狀態(tài),直至下一個(gè)字符數(shù)據(jù)的起始位到來。 所謂標(biāo)準(zhǔn)接口,就是明確定義若干信號(hào)線,使接口電路標(biāo)準(zhǔn)化、通用化,借助串行通信標(biāo)準(zhǔn)接口,不同類型的數(shù)據(jù)通信設(shè)備可以很容易實(shí)現(xiàn)它們之間的串行通信連接。數(shù) 沖 收 收 寄 存 發(fā) 寄 在 UART中,完成數(shù)據(jù)串行化的電路屬發(fā)送器,而實(shí)現(xiàn)數(shù)據(jù)反串行化處理的電路則屬接收器。3.錯(cuò)誤檢驗(yàn) 錯(cuò)誤檢驗(yàn)的目的在于檢驗(yàn)數(shù)據(jù)通信過程是否正確。這兩個(gè)寄存器有同一地址( 99H)。 MCS51的串行口及控制寄存器圖 812 MCS51串行口寄存器結(jié)構(gòu) MCS51的串行口及控制寄存器一、串行口寄存器結(jié)構(gòu) 發(fā)送 SBUF( 99H)接收 SUBF( 99H)輸入移位寄存器TI(發(fā)送中斷)TXD串行輸出8051內(nèi)部總線RXD串行輸入RI(接收輸入)移位時(shí)鐘圖 523 MCS51串行口寄存器結(jié)構(gòu) MCS51的串行口及控制寄存器能 波特 方式 0 同步移位寄存器 fosc/1210 當(dāng)串行口以方式 2或方式 3接收時(shí),如 SM2 =在方式 0時(shí), SM2必須為 0。1時(shí),允許接收數(shù)據(jù),當(dāng) REN = 發(fā)送中斷被響應(yīng)后, TI不會(huì)自動(dòng)復(fù)位,必須由 軟件復(fù)位 。因此, RI RI亦必須由 軟件清 “0”。字節(jié)地址為 87H。系統(tǒng)復(fù)位時(shí), SMOD=0。 MCS51的串行口及控制寄存器位 序AFAEADACABAAA9 A8位符號(hào)EA / /ESET1EX1ET0EX0 MCS51的串行口及控制寄存器一、串行口工作方式 0DATARXDCD4014CLK串行口與 CD4014配合 MCS51串行通信工作方式及其應(yīng)用DATARXD當(dāng)串行口把 8位狀態(tài)碼串行移位輸出后, TI置 1。其幀格式為:起始D0 D1 D2 D3 D4 D5 D6 D7 停止⑴ MCS51串行通信工作方式及其應(yīng)用=直到停止位到來之后把停止位送入 RB8中,并置位中斷標(biāo)志位 RI,通知 CPU從 SBUF取走接收到的一個(gè)字符。方式 0的波特率是固定的( fosc/12),但方式 1的波特率則是可變的。32之所以選擇工作方式 2,是因?yàn)榉绞?2具有 自動(dòng)加載功能 ,可以避免通過程序反復(fù)裝入初值所引起的 定時(shí)誤差 ,使波特率更穩(wěn)定。故波特率計(jì)算公式為:實(shí)際使用時(shí),總是先確定波特率,再計(jì)算定時(shí)器 1的計(jì)數(shù)初值,然后進(jìn)行定時(shí)器的初始化。 MCS51串行通信工作方式及其應(yīng)用三、 SETBCLRTB8 ; TB8位置 “0”方式 2的接收過程也與方式 1基本相似,所不同的只在第 9數(shù)據(jù)位上。 方式 3方式 3同樣是 11位為一幀的串行通信方式,其通信過程與方式 2完全相同,所不同的僅在于波特率。 MCS51串行通信工作方式及其應(yīng)用 RXDRXD此外,各從機(jī)要進(jìn)行編址,以便主機(jī)能按地址尋找通信伙伴。2)主機(jī)置位 RB8 ,發(fā)送要尋址的從機(jī)地址。6)主從機(jī)之間進(jìn)行數(shù)據(jù)通信。 PC機(jī)與單片機(jī)通信時(shí),發(fā)送和接收工作狀態(tài)見圖 819中的虛線。只要 PC機(jī)屏幕上顯示的字符與鍵入的字符相同,即表明 PC機(jī)與單片機(jī)間通信正常。程序流程框圖如圖 PC機(jī)與 8051間的通信圖 821 8051單片機(jī)通信軟件框圖 PC機(jī)與 8051間的通信謝謝觀看 /歡迎下載BY FAITH I MEAN A VISION OF GOOD ONE CHERISHES AND THE ENTHUSIASM THAT PUSHES ONE TO SEEK ITS FULFILLMENT REGARDLESS OF OBSTACLES. BY FAITH I BY FAIT
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1